Thermosphere-Ionosphere Modeling with Forecastable Inputs: Case Study of the June 2012 High Speed Stream Geomagnetic Storm
This is the companion dataset for the Journal paper ”Thermosphere-Ionosphere Modeling With Forecastable Inputs: Case Study of the June 2012 High Speed Stream Geomagnetic Storm” (under review). The dataset contains raw outputs from a global ionosphere-thermosphere model for a geomagnetic storm events. The outputs are in IDL binary format, containing the model solution of the total electron content, the magnetic field, density, velocity, and temperature for neutral and ion species. The outputs are analyzed in the paper to evaluate the forecast capability of the model.
